Smart Plant Watering System

The Smart plant allows you to automate the watering of your plant with the particle Argon while measuring room and soil conditions

projectImage

Things used in this project

 

Hardware components

HARDWARE LIST
1 DFRobot Gravity: Analog Capacitive Soil Moisture Sensor- Corrosion Resistant
1 Particle Argon
1 ElectroPeak 0.96" OLED 64x128 Display Module
1 SparkFun Atmospheric Sensor Breakout - BME280
1 Seeed Studio Grove - Air quality sensor v1.3
1 Seeed Studio Grove - Dust Sensor(PPD42NS)
1 Submersible Water Pump
1 General Purpose Transistor NPN
1 Resistor 2.21k ohm
1 Resistor 220 ohm
1 Relay Module (Generic)

Hand tools and fabrication machines

 

cnc router

 

Laser cutter (generic)

 

3D Printer (generic)

Story

 

The project was created as part of Iot Deep Dive Bootcamp at CNM Ingenuity. The system utilizes soil moisture as the indicator for watering the plant. As the system is connected via internet, the particle argon connects with both Zapier and adafruit.io to interface with the user.

projectImage

The Neo Pixels will glow based on the room conditions:

projectImage
projectImage
projectImage

A dashboard has been created in adafruit.io to display room conditions live of dust, air quality, temperature and humidity. There are buttons for a manual water mode as well as a neopixel control.

projectImage

Custom parts and enclosures

icon smartplantcad_F6JMQWvVUp.zip 1.79MB Download(7)

Schematics

Fritzing

projectImage

Code

icon SmartPlant-main.zip 379KB Download(8)

The article was first published in hackster, March 24 2022

cr: https://www.hackster.io/arjun-bhakta/smart-plant-watering-system-e08a57

author: Arjun Bhakta

License
All Rights
Reserved
licensBg
0